Backend JavaScript developer
Company profile
We are a rapidly growing company focused on delivering innovative online collaboration and communication platforms. With a focus on improving productivity and engagement within organizations, we develop tools for onboarding, smart employee conversations, satisfaction surveys, and more. The organization is structured around four teams working on different aspects of the platform, including maintaining and expanding existing functionalities, developing new features, and improving backend infrastructure.
Role description
As a Backend Developer, you'll play a crucial role in modernizing their backend codebase. You'll work on transitioning their monolithic architecture to a scalable microservices architecture, leveraging your expertise in NodeJS and NestJS. You'll collaborate closely with cross-functional teams to develop new features, improve existing code, and enhance the overall quality of their software.
Responsibilities:
- Contributing to the development of backend functionalities using NodeJS and NestJS.
- Improving code quality, scalability, and maintainability.
- Collaborating with senior developers and participating in code reviews.
- Optimizing application efficiency and performance.
- Staying up-to-date with the latest developments and technologies in backend development.
Requirements
- Minimum 2 years of experience as a backend developer with NodeJS.
- Minimum 6 months of experience with NestJS.
- Good communication skills and the ability to effectively communicate with technical and non-technical stakeholders.
- Experience with Agile development and DevOps practices is a plus.
- Passion for clean code and best practices such as DRY, KISS, and unit testing.
Benefits
- Salary up to €5500.
- A challenging and dynamic work environment.
- The opportunity to contribute to the growth of a rapidly growing company.
- Opportunities for personal and professional development with a budget.
- ClassPass.
- Hybrid work environment.
- Always healthy lunches.
What are you waiting for? Get in touch with l.verweij@haystackpeople.nl or call +31620293364.
Zo werkt solliciteren
De intake
Waar liggen jouw ambities, groeimogelijkheden en wensen als professional? Wij challengen jou om je ideale plaatje helder te krijgen.
Battle plan
Een menukaart is er niets bij. Wij leggen jou een selectie aan bedrijven voor voordat we ten aanval overgaan.
Interviews
Een goede eerste indruk maak je maar 1 keer en een goede voorbereiding het halve werk. Natuurlijk doen wij dit samen!
Gefeliciteerd!
Een wederzijdse match? Mooi! Voordat we jou officieel feliciteren, zorgen we voor de beste deal.
Gerelateerde vacatures
Backend Engineer (Python, HealthTech Platform, Build from Scratch)
As a Backend Engineer, you will help build the core of a fast-growing healthtech platform …
ScaleUp
Vast
130k
Backend Engineer (Python, FastAPI, Platform)
As a Backend Engineer, you will help build and scale the backend systems of a fast-growing …
ScaleUp
Vast
130k
Typescript developer
Bouwen aan software die direct machines aanstuurt via een eigen MES systeem. Volledig clou …
Vast
70k
Meld je aan voor de job-alert
Laat ons weten wat je zoekt. Dan weten wij jou meteen te vinden als we een vacature hebben die bij jou past!
Inschrijven job alert